SUMMARY

When a loop is rotated in the opposite direction by the same amount, the change in magnetic flux exhibits specific characteristics. The correct answers are that it has the same magnitude and the opposite sign. This is due to the principles of electromagnetic induction, where the direction of the magnetic field influences the sign of the flux change. Understanding these principles is crucial for accurately predicting the behavior of magnetic systems.
